## Add retry handling for the Norvane partner SFTP drop

This PR hardens the nightly pull from the Norvane drop directory. We now verify file manifests before ingest, quarantine partial uploads, and back off on connection resets instead of failing the whole batch. Behavior is unchanged for clean runs. The retry and timeout constants introduced here are listed below.

tuning table, kajog-kawef:
PRIORITIES = {
    "kelox": 870,
    "kasix": 89,
    "eliax": 988,
}

To my successor, for circulation to sales leads: negotiations with Tarnwell on the proposed Lanebrook venture are at term-sheet stage. Commercial scope covers co-selling in the Estvale corridor, with revenue shared on a tiered basis still under discussion. Their team is cautious on exclusivity; we have held firm so far. Please keep field teams from pre-selling anything until signature. All working papers are in the shared drive. The confidential note on our negotiating position follows immediately below.

internal memo for kawip-hadug: Headcount on the Wenwyn team goes from 7 to 140 by the end of January. Gross margin on Wenwyn came in at 20 percent against a plan of 15 percent.

## Service Accounts: Dark-Mode Theming (Bridgevane Admin)

External plugins rendering inside the Bridgevane admin dashboard must respect the active theme token rather than hardcoding palettes. Theme state is fetched from the theming service via a shared service account scoped to read-only. Plugins query the theme endpoint at load using the key below.

API key for tagug-tajef: vxb4-R1fo

## Contrast Audit — Provenance

For sync: the Pinebarrow contrast audit now runs as a gated stage in the Ashgate pipeline. Every merge to main triggers the checker against the full component library; failures block release. Results are archived per-build with the source commit, token palette version, and ruleset hash, so any flagged regression can be traced to an exact theme change. No manual overrides without a sign-off from the design-systems rotation. Current passing build's trace token follows.

pipeline stamp: htk9_fa6ea24b2